Where is Jibujue?
Where is Jibujue located?
Jibujue, Sichuan, China (approx. 28.4716°, 102.7321°)
Where is Jibujue on the map?
Jibujue - Qianghelejie
Jibujue - Pusyun
Jibujue - Jihaoyuanjia
{"latitude":28.4716,"longitude":102.7321,"title":"Jibujue"}